  • Patent number: 5215568
    Abstract: This disclosure describes new 5-oximio-2-(2-imidazolin-2-yl) pyridines having the following structure: ##STR1## wherein Y is hydrogen, C.sub.1 -C.sub.4 branched or unbranched alkyl optionally substituted with C.sub.1 -C.sub.4 alkoxy, C.sub.1 -C.sub.4 alkylthiol, halogen, CO.sub.2 R.sub.4, CN, NHCOR.sub.5, OCOR.sub.4, furyl or a phenyl group optionally substituted with one or two halogens, C.sub.1 -C.sub.2 alkyl or nitro, C.sub.1 -C.sub.4 alkenyl optionally substituted with halogen or C.sub.1 -C.sub.4 alkoxy, or C.sub.1 -C.sub.4 alkynyl; and Z is hydrogen or C.sub.1 -C.sub.4 alkyl. The disclosure further describes the unique method of using the compounds as herbicidal agents and the methods for their preparation.
